I think it's really bright because I spoke the last month at UCLA to a graduate level class.
There's probably 200 people in the class.
And I said, raise your hand if you have cable.
and not a single student raised their hand.
And so we're just living in a totally different media landscape than we were when I grew up and I had three channels on my TV and you had to mess with the rabbit ears to get Fox.
And so it's really important for especially sports like X Games where our demo is young.
I mean, we dominate teens.
We dominate sort of Gen Zs and early millennials.
Like no sports property can sort of match that type of audience and engagement.
X Games have been setting youth culture for three decades with skateboarding and BMX and skiing and snowboarding.
